WMC is a carbon neutral commodity merchant and operates globally at the intersection of physical raw material trading and finance. We connect producers and consumers of nuclear fuel and battery raw materials across the world and combine this with innovative financial structuring solutions to further enable the global energy transition. WMC acts both on a principal and agent basis and is one of the largest traders of nuclear fuel products globally. In addition, WMC also develops strategic chemical processing assets critical for the lithium-ion battery market on a principal basis. WMC employs a highly-skilled, lean team across Europe, the US and Asia with a complementary set of backgrounds in investment banking, commodity trading and mining & processing.
